WebStarting at the water heater, measure lengths of insulation needed to cover all accessible hot water pipes, especially the first 3 feet of pipe from the water heater. It's also a good idea to insulate the cold-water inlet pipes for the first 3 feet. 2) Cut the pipe sleeve. Cut the insulation to the lengths needed. 3) Place the pipe sleeve. WebOct 14, 2024 · Pipes can freeze in as little as six to eight hours, meaning they can freeze overnight. If the outside temperature is below 32 degrees F and your pipes are unprotected, your chances for a frozen pipe increase. Indoor pipes are more protected, typically requiring 20 F or lower for freezing to occur, according to the International Code Council.

If you have a high-efficiency furnace, then its PVC exhaust pipes will need to be sloped towards the furnace. Specifically, most installations require a minimum of ¼” of slope per foot of pipe. This allows the furnace condensate to flow back towards the furnace’s drain pipe. how to remove fegli
